The fuses can easily be replaced with inline blade type fuse holders. Just do 1 fuse at a time. Cut the wires right at the old fuse box, add the new fuse holder. Solder and heat shrink tubing. move to the next set of wires. Repeat till all done.
On the safety relay. It can be replaced with a standard lighting relay, the one with 5 terminals, as far as the safety interlock on the starter. Hook the yellow wire to terminal 85, hook the black wire to 86. Hook one red/wite wire to 30 the other red/white wire to 87A.
